Join the City of Perth Library to learn about the health benefits of incorporating regular movement into your life.
Sitting has become a larger part of our lives, particularly with working from home, periods of quarantine and self-isolation, and activities like watching television and playing video games. Join us to explore the impact that significant periods of sitting has on our health, and learn tips and techniques to help you incorporate more activity in your daily routine. The session will be followed by a light morning tea and a walk around the Library precinct.
This talk will be presented by Women’s Health and Family Services.
